This is my most ambitious undertaking to date as far as casting goes. The cap is abalone shell of my own casting. The body of the pen is black acrylic that I cast. It was turned and then abalone shell was inlaid. It was then covered with CA.

It was a good bit of work and I had a couple false starts and re-dos, but in the end I am pretty happy with it.

I wish I would of had a better kit to put it on. It is a SN Gent from Timberbits. This is my first full size pen. It would probably look good on a Platinum and black Ti kit of some sort.
